

Arriving back in the UK after TWU I was put straight on a project doing 4 X 10h day weeks in the North of England. Although this meant being away from home during the week the team had a fairly large number of ThoughtWorkers and at least one client person in the same situation so it was very social with us hanging out in the bars of Knutsford most nights of the week. The project was a fantastic experience to follow on from TWU; we ran a fairly pure Agile methodology and the client was very pleased with our end product. The team was also great not only because they were a good group of people but there were many experienced people I could learn new things from each and every day.
After rolling off at the end of that project, I was offered the chance to travel to the US or Australia to work on projects that we were having trouble staffing with enough people. I chose Australia as it provided an excellent way to get home to Melbourne and catch up with all my friends there as well as escape the English winter for an Aussie summer.
My first 3 months were on a project which was facing challenges. The client was trying to optimise output and had doubled the team size with contractors from another consultancy. Needless to say this was a challenging situation to face after my previous project. It worked out well though, I paired for 3 months, reinforcing unit testing and other technical practices across the whole team - working with client and other consultancy developers.
After Christmas I joined a project for an internal application for a huge Australian company. The work has been interesting and challenging and we are again using a fairly pure Agile approach. We have some challenges, but I'm beginning to see those as the 'interesting' bits as there are usually creative ways through.
The staff in Melbourne have been great to hang out with and with so many out-of-towners in Australia at the moment I have found myself becoming a tourist in my own country again, showing them around.
All in all I've had a very enjoyable time and have learnt a lot. All said I am also looking forward to heading back to the UK from my Australia posting towards the end of June and catching up with everyone there again too.
